About Cable group's Workforce

Kabel Indústria e Comércio de Chicotes Elétricos Ltda is an Electronics Manufacturing company that employs 553 people worldwide as of March 2026. It is the 11th-largest by headcount among its peers. Founded in 1975, the company is headquartered in Curitiba, Brazil.

Cable group's workforce has declined 3.2% from 2023 to 2026, down 1.2% year over year in 2026. It fell to a low of 543 in 2024 Q1 before recovering. Its workforce is concentrated most in Brazil (98.5%), followed by Mexico (0.5%) and Turkey (0.4%), with Brazil, its fastest-growing location.

Cable group's largest functional groups are Finance and Operations (47.8%), Sales and Marketing (28.9%), and Engineering (23.3%), with Sales and Marketing growing fastest (up 7.9%). Median employee tenure is 3.1 years. The average salary is $6,867, highest in Southern America at a median of $6,000.

Cable group's active job postings fell 200.0% in 2026 to 0. Overall employee sentiment is neutral but declining.
